Transaction 89cbcc9cfafe331378017eaa4b928c35750a92c39ef01af4be504e7a6cec7d82
1 Input
2 Outputs
- 89cbcc9cfafe331378017eaa4b928c35750a92c39ef01af4be504e7a6cec7d82:0
- 89cbcc9cfafe331378017eaa4b928c35750a92c39ef01af4be504e7a6cec7d82:1
value 1037329
address 1DvPsCpbpMcc8CngYRmFw8SmiUpDoGDnYj
value 32759
address 12VHe1J7dUwK3rF2EECWmC7BfviyMrHqnd